The story of <I¡¯m a Cyborg, but that¡¯s OK> begin in an unexpected place.

After Director Park Chan-Wook dreamed about a girl who shoots bullets out of her body, he developed this impressive dream into a movie about a sweet love story of pure-hearted and unusual characters, and has various stories in it. ¡°Shin Se Gye (New World) Asylum¡±, the background of this movie, is different from any asylum usually symbolized as a gloomy and cruel place. With the pastel-tone colors, the asylum became a place filled with silly imaginations and fantasies and it will show a different visual from Park¡¯s previous works.

After completing 3 revenge series, Park shows an unusual love story with an unfamiliar combination of ¡®asylum + cyborg +romantic comedy¡¯ through <I¡¯m a Cyborg, but that¡¯s OK> which will be remembered as his new trial and his brightest movie.

 

** Official invitation to international movie festival

- Invited to 57th Berlin International Film Festival's Competition section.

- Opened 1st Hong Kong International Film Festival on Mar. 19, 2007.

- Closed South by Southwest Film Festival on Mar. 17, 2007 in Austin, Texas.

 

** Award

Alfred Bauer Prize in Berlin International film festival.
